Info about Single Case Agreements

Many of our clients who are not members of participating insurance plans have obtained single case agreements (SCA) from their insurance company, which allow OON insurance clients to get services at CAASS at in-network terms.

Basically if you get a SCA, CAASS providers are in-network just for you.

We have had a high success rate obtaining SCA from Aetna and a few other insurance plans that are regulated by the state of Ohio** for clients with suspected or diagnosed Autism. CAASS will bill for you if you have a single case agreement.

**Some insurance plans are regulated by the federal government, including most employer funded plans. These federally regulated plans have been more difficult to get SCA’s from.
